Weather and Man Made Snow in Jackson Hole

On an annual basis, Jackson Hole's average frozen precipitation is 1165.8cm.

This natural weather-created snowfall is helped along with 40 snow guns or "cannons" on ?km of piste - that's over 16% of the total length of Jackson Hole trails.

Off-piste snowboarding and sking is allowed and of course this has the secondary effect of reducing the wear and tear on snow condition on the pisted runs.

Ski area & ski slope orientation - N S E W

The ski slopes in the Jackson Hole ski area face in these directions: N S E W

Top Tips:

In the coldest winter months of January and February choose a resort with south facing areas, more light and warmth in the depths of alpine winter.

In warmer spring months the best riding is on cooler and shady North facing slopes.
